Output 80e1a4a6da19ca7b18df1c1c8c0b520e557e9d021e557ae3170f25ce1bc8ed33:3

value
103743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21231611bb0da43db87150d0afb5994b8ca1f28c OP_EQUAL
address
34iEFhwMqSS3sVjpqee4y4hH8E3hApHrxe
transaction
80e1a4a6da19ca7b18df1c1c8c0b520e557e9d021e557ae3170f25ce1bc8ed33
spent
true